AEW wrestlers debate impact of extreme matches on younger audiences

Posted at: September 15, 2024 - 4:45 PM

TBS Champion Mercedes Mone has expressed mixed feelings about the extreme nature of some matches in AEW. While she understands that hardcore action appeals to certain fans, she worries it might turn away younger viewers, especially children. Former AEW Women’s Champion Thunder Rosa shared her thoughts on this, acknowledging that violent matches have been crucial to her career but recognizing that not everyone enjoys such content.

Rosa pointed out that AEW is known for pushing boundaries in wrestling, but she agrees that fans have the right to feel uncomfortable with extreme violence. She revealed that some fans left the recent AEW All Out event early because their children were upset by the intense scenes. Mone had previously mentioned not wanting her younger brother to witness such violence.

Both wrestlers emphasized the need for caution when watching AEW content. Rosa stated that some of the material is not suitable for younger audiences and is intended for adults. This highlights the ongoing debate in professional wrestling about balancing exciting, intense action with content that’s appropriate for all ages.
